Channelknight Fadran Posted March 14, 2023 Author Report Share Posted March 14, 2023 It was freezing outside. A harsh, biting wind came from the north. Kris quickly handed out all the heavy coats he'd brought along, along with little potted ferns radiating a small (but noticeable) amount of heat. They had come out of a door built directly into the mountainside, overlooking a jagged cragscape of cliff and stone. Mountain after mountain stole at the horizon, shooting up past the clouds and covered in snow. From the foot each was coated in trees, and past there were the gleaming green fields - but up here that seemed miles away, and instead just the ice waited for them. "Okay!" Kris had to speak loud to be heard in this wind. He reached into his pocket and brought out a single flower: a daisy, pressed onto a paper etched with symbols. With this he summoned the doorway to his supplies, cracking it open to glance at all the plants he'd needed to accumulate for this trip.
